N2 - It is greatly important to restrict power consumption of running trains for reducing power consumption cost. This study aims to control the train's power demand, average power consumption in 30 minutes, utilizing decentralized control scheme. This control system is a server-less system and is advantageous from the view point of plug play and capital investment. In this work, it was verified that this control scheme can achieve the power demand control by the fundamental train running experiment.
